Undergraduate students take part in speed networking event

Undergraduate students from the Management School recently took part in a Year in Industry speed networking session as part of the University’s Spring Careers Fair.

The event took place at The Crypt Hall in Liverpool’s Metropolitan Cathedral and allowed students to meet a number of placement employers to find out more about the opportunities available and ask questions about the application process.

Sandra Hughes, Placements and Internships Coordinator at the Management School, commented “The networking event was a great opportunity for students to find out more about placement opportunities.  It also enabled them to talk directly to employers in an informal setting so they could get the information they need.”

The Year in Industry programme is available to all undergraduate students and involves taking a placement year as part of their degree to help develop the key skills graduate employers look for.  The speed networking session formed part of the support offered by the careers team to help students improve their employability and prepare for their Year in Industry.
